Wood-Ridge High School is a four-year comprehensive public high school that serves students in seventh through twelfth grade from Wood-Ridge, in Bergen County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ey, operating as the lone secondary school of the Wood-Ridge School District. The school was established in 1922.

As of the 2023–24 school year, the school had an enrollment of 522 students and 46.4 classroom teachers (on an FTE basis), for a student–teacher ratio of 11.3:1. There were 7 students (1.3% of enrollment) eligible for free lunch and 23 (4.4% of students) eligible for reduced-cost lunch.

Approximately 100 public school students from Moonachie attend Wood-Ridge High School, as part of a sending/receiving relationship with the Moonachie School District.
